"This law is the victory of an ideological conception of parity, disconnected from the reality of the ground"

Summary by Marianne
By imposing the list vote on municipalities with less than 1,000 inhabitants, the government claims to strengthen parity, but is likely to suffocate local democracy. A reform thought from Paris, far from the realities of the field, according to the deputy of Cher, Loïc Kervran (Horizons), and Solène Le Monnier, president of the national union of local elected officials, co-authors of a forum for Marianne.
